MK2 Tints with Custom Metas

Has anyone else noticed that MK2 weapon skins break when you stream MK2 weapon metas? I am not sure if Rockstar placed the MK2 tints in a separate meta since there are 31, but I don’t see them within the original metas that I pull from OpenIV. If anyone has any idea how to fix this please let me know, I can’t find the component names of the new tints.

-EDIT:

If anyone knows how to use ’ GetPedWeaponLiveryColor’ (more specifically, what or how do i find p3 camoComponentHash ) or any other method of assigning a MK2 weapon tint, please let me know.

If anyone has this issue, you need to ensure you have “TintSpecValues” defined for every MK2 weapon.

If I find the original values for the ‘TINT_GUNRUNNING’ then I will post them here, else we each have to define our own values until some one releases a standard pack.

1 Like

Looks like the actual values do not have any affect on the weapon, we just need to make sure that they exist.

I figured out this method is limited to 7 skins due to SetPedWeaponTintIndex having a limited index. I am guessing there is a different native for calling the mk2 skins such as GetPedWeaponLiveryColor maybe.

For anyone reading this topic in 2023 and having the same problem, this is likely due to your copy of weapons.meta predating the Gunrunning update and thus not having the required entry in TintSpecValues. It can be found in update\update.rpf\common\data\ai\weapons.meta as follows:

<Item>
      <Name>TINT_GUNRUNNING</Name>
       <Tints>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000e7e3d1"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x0000000061605b"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x0000000061605b"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.7500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="2.000000" />
          <Spec2Color value="0x00000000469bbd"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000009d8e68"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000536941" />
        </Item>
        <Item>
         <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000cfe7fc"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.750000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000736548"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000736548"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.800000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000a62828"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.800000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000006d28a6"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.800000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000008a7848"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.800000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000fbefde"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.750000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000de2c8e" />
        </Item>
        <Item>
          <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.750000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000003052b8" />
        </Item>
        <Item>
         <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.7500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000de802c" />
        </Item>
        <Item>
         <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.7500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000b330b8" />
        </Item>
        <Item>
         <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.5000000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000593f3f"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000003f5946" />
        </Item>
        <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x000000003f5659" />
        </Item>
        <Item>
         <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.5000000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x0000000058593f" />
        </Item>
        <Item>
         <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.7500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000c22929" />
        </Item>
        <Item>
         <SpecFresnel value="0.75000" />
          <SpecFalloffMult value="60.000000" />
          <SpecIntMult value="0.7500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000298ac2"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="2.000000" />
          <Spec2Color value="0x00000000b08100"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1.000000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="2.000000" />
          <Spec2Color value="0x00000000d9f7ff"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1.000000" />
          <Spec2Factor value="115.000000" />
          <Spec2ColorInt value="3.000000" />
          <Spec2Color value="0x00000000f576b7"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="45.000000" />
          <Spec2ColorInt value="3.000000" />
          <Spec2Color value="0x0000000075fa00"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="115.000000" />
          <Spec2ColorInt value="3.000000" />
          <Spec2Color value="0x00000000ff3300"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="115.000000" />
          <Spec2ColorInt value="3.000000" />
          <Spec2Color value="0x0000000043f0b9"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="115.000000" />
          <Spec2ColorInt value="3.000000" />
          <Spec2Color value="0x0000000010b4e6" />
        </Item>
        <Item>
          <SpecFresnel value="0.950000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1" />
          <Spec2Factor value="52.000000" />
          <Spec2ColorInt value="4.000000" />
          <Spec2Color value="0x0000000000ffd9" />
        </Item>
         <Item>
          <SpecFresnel value="0.95000" />
          <SpecFalloffMult value="100.000000" />
          <SpecIntMult value="1.000000" />
          <Spec2Factor value="52.000000" />
          <Spec2ColorInt value="4.000000" />
          <Spec2Color value="0x00000000ff6200" />
        </Item>
          <Item>
          <SpecFresnel value="0.80000" />
          <SpecFalloffMult value="40.000000" />
          <SpecIntMult value="0.500000" />
          <Spec2Factor value="20.000000" />
          <Spec2ColorInt value="1.000000" />
          <Spec2Color value="0x00000000e7e3d1" />
        </Item>
      </Tints>
    </Item>